Trump’s Bitcoin Reserve Plan: What Was Announced?

Donald Trump’s administration has taken an unprecedented step by proposing a Strategic Bitcoin Reserve, aiming to position the United States as a key player in the global cryptocurrency economy. According to the official statement, the plan involves:

Acquiring Bitcoin as a National Reserve Asset – The U.S. government intends to allocate a portion of its financial resources to buy Bitcoin and store it as a strategic reserve.

Regulatory Measures for Crypto Companies – Stricter oversight of crypto exchanges and platforms will be introduced to curb fraud and illicit activities.

Tax Incentives for Crypto Businesses – Certain incentives will be offered to crypto-related businesses that comply with new government regulations.

Introduction of a Digital Dollar Framework – A plan to introduce a government-backed digital currency (CBDC) alongside Bitcoin reserves.

While this move appeared promising on the surface, it quickly became clear that investors were not entirely convinced by the execution strategy.

Market Reaction: A Sharp Decline In Crypto Prices

Almost immediately after the announcement, the cryptocurrency market reacted negatively. Bitcoin, which had been trading at around $72,000, plunged to $65,000 within hours. Ethereum, which was on track for a breakout, dropped by 8%, and altcoins followed the downward trajectory.

Why Did Investors React Negatively?

Several factors contributed to the decline in market confidence:

Lack of Transparency in Implementation

The lack of a clear roadmap for how the Bitcoin Reserve would be structured created uncertainty. Investors were left questioning how the U.S. government planned to acquire and store Bitcoin, and whether it would be managed efficiently.

Fear of Government Overreach in Crypto Markets

One of the core principles of cryptocurrency is decentralization. Trump’s plan introduced elements of government control that many in the crypto community viewed as a potential threat. Regulatory measures within the plan suggested increased scrutiny on crypto transactions, raising concerns about potential market restrictions.

Concerns About Market Manipulation

Some analysts feared that a U.S.-controlled Bitcoin reserve could lead to government manipulation of the market. If the U.S. were to acquire large amounts of Bitcoin, it could theoretically influence market prices in ways that contradict the principles of free trade.

Unclear Position on Altcoins and DeFi

While the Bitcoin Reserve plan focused on Bitcoin, there was no clear indication of how the administration planned to address Ethereum, altcoins, and decentralized finance (DeFi) projects. This uncertainty led to a broader sell-off in the market.

Regulatory Implications: What Comes Next?

Beyond the immediate price drop, Trump’s Bitcoin Reserve plan raises long-term questions about how cryptocurrencies will be regulated.

Increased Government Oversight – The plan suggests more stringent compliance measures for exchanges and crypto businesses, which could impact trading volume.

Taxation Policies – With a government-backed reserve, new tax policies on crypto transactions and holdings may emerge.

Potential for a U.S. CBDC (Central Bank Digital Currency) – The plan’s mention of a Digital Dollar Framework indicates a possible push toward a U.S. central bank digital currency (CBDC), which could compete with stablecoins.

Impact on Global Crypto Adoption – If the U.S. formally integrates Bitcoin into its financial system, other nations may follow, altering the global crypto landscape.
